Jul-21-17  hemy: <Delboy> Indeed brilliant game of A.Z.Macht with double piece sacrifice.

It was published in "Wiener Schach-Zeitung" Nr.1, 1932, pp.9-11 with comments of Sandor Takacs

It was also published in many other periodicals and books. The position before 16th move of White with short comments of Gideon Stahlberg was placed on page 13 of the "Tidskrift for Schack" Jan-Feb 1932.

In May 2014 I received from Henryk Konaszczuk, Polish chess historian, article from "Kuryer Literacko-Naukowy", (July 4, 1932, p.27) which included this game.
